A Microsoft Azure Case Study
Jamia Co-operative Bank, a Delhi‑based urban cooperative bank with 8 branches, over 67,000 account holders and $11 million in deposits (along with 15 other cooperative banks in India), faced growing operational inefficiencies. Its legacy, branch‑level TBA and distributed databases could not scale to meet rising transaction volumes, inter-branch reconciliation and RBI compliance requirements—challenges that intensified after the demonetization-driven surge in digital payments.
NIIT Technologies deployed its BankingEasy core banking solution and migrated the platform to Microsoft Azure’s Indian datacenters, providing a centralized, managed CBS with built‑in security and data‑residency compliance. The cloud migration delivered scalable, high‑performing, always‑available banking services, stronger analytics and disaster recovery (industry‑leading RTO/RPO), faster product go‑to‑market and the digital capabilities mid‑tier banks need to offer large‑bank customer experiences.
